BOLT browser brings Indian Language support


BOLT is a feature rich mobile browser which supports a wide variety of phones . It supports both Flash and HTML5 video and comes with social network integration. Today BOLT announced that the BOLT browser supports Indic aka Indian regional languages in them. The users also can input the Indic fonts too. This is made possible by BOLT cloud computing browsing platform and  BOLT mobile browser with Indic language user interfaces,  to perfectly render Indic text on a Web page, and the ability for end users to input Indic text into the browser. Tata Docomo Unveils New Offers For MNP

Tata Docomo is the first private operator to announce its MNP offers. Tata Docomo will offer additional talktime on recharge vouchers of Rs.100, Rs.200, Rs.300 and Rs.400. Along with that, you will get 100 MB data free per month for 6 months.

We have a reason to cheer, since the much awaited MNP (Mobile Number Portability) will be finally rolled out today in Rohtak district of Haryana. For those who are unfamiliar with MNP, let me once again tell you that Mobile Number Portability is the process by which, you can shift to another operator of your choice without changing your old number. Intex Launches India’s First Projector Phone – V.Show

Intex Technologies recently announced the launch of Intex ‘V.SHOW’ – a path-breaking mobile handset with an inbuilt projector. Inter V.Show is India’s first projector phone to be launched by a domestic mobile handset company.
